Multi Word Blocks

Depending on how you arrange the letters on the blocks, you can spell 16 words:

Harvest
Family
Blessed
Monster
Welcome
Spooky
Snow
Mother
Friends
Winter
Home
Dream
Faith
Freedom
Hope
Easter

All these words are made using seven blocks (depending on the word). So, the blocks you are not using you can just store a few and then when you feel like changing the word in your house simply just rearrange the blocks to spell a new word.

Each block has the following letters: (2 sides of each block will be left blank)

Block 1- f,b,t,w
Block 2- m,e,d,o
Block 3- c,s,a,r
Block 4- e,p,t,r
Block 5- n,l,v,o
Block 6- s,i,m,k
Block 7- y,e,h,d

Here is what you will need:

Scrapbooking paper to match you home decor
7 blocks cut and sanded to 3 1/2 inch by 3 1/2
paint to match your decor
Modge Podge
We cut our letters out of scrapbook papers using my Cricket.
